package gossiputil
import (
"sync"
"testing"
"github.com/cockroachdb/cockroach/gossip"
"github.com/cockroachdb/cockroach/roachpb"
)
// StoreGossiper allows tests to push storeDescriptors into gossip and
// synchronize on their callbacks. There can only be one storeGossiper used per
// gossip instance.
type StoreGossiper struct {
g *gossip.Gossip
wg sync.WaitGroup
mu sync.Mutex
storeKeyMap map[string]struct{}
}
// NewStoreGossiper creates a store gossiper for use by tests. It adds the
// callback to gossip.
func NewStoreGossiper(g *gossip.Gossip) *StoreGossiper {
sg := &StoreGossiper{
g: g,
storeKeyMap: make(map[string]struct{}),
}
g.RegisterCallback(gossip.MakePrefixPattern(gossip.KeyStorePrefix), func(key string, _ roachpb.Value) {
sg.mu.Lock()
defer sg.mu.Unlock()
if _, ok := sg.storeKeyMap[key]; ok {
sg.wg.Done()
}
})
return sg
}
// GossipStores queues up a list of stores to gossip and blocks until each one
// is gossiped before returning.
func (sg *StoreGossiper) GossipStores(stores []*roachpb.StoreDescriptor, t *testing.T) {
sg.mu.Lock()
sg.storeKeyMap = make(map[string]struct{})
sg.wg.Add(len(stores))
for _, s := range stores {
storeKey := gossip.MakeStoreKey(s.StoreID)
sg.storeKeyMap[storeKey] = struct{}{}
// Gossip store descriptor.
err := sg.g.AddInfoProto(storeKey, s, 0)
if err != nil {
t.Fatal(err)
}
}
sg.mu.Unlock()
// Wait for all gossip callbacks to be invoked.
sg.wg.Wait()
}
// GossipWithFunction is similar to GossipStores but instead of gossiping the
// store descriptors directly, call the passed in function to do so.
func (sg *StoreGossiper) GossipWithFunction(stores []roachpb.StoreID, gossiper func()) {
sg.mu.Lock()
sg.storeKeyMap = make(map[string]struct{})
sg.wg.Add(len(stores))
for _, s := range stores {
storeKey := gossip.MakeStoreKey(s)
sg.storeKeyMap[storeKey] = struct{}{}
}
// Gossip the stores via the passed in function.
gossiper()
sg.mu.Unlock()
// Wait for all gossip callbacks to be invoked.
sg.wg.Wait()
}
